In the preparation of samples for analyses while engaged in an investigation of the zeolites of Nova Scotia, the writer learned that Sonstadt’s mercuric potassic iodide solution may not be used either for separations or for specific gravity determinations in the case of some of the zeolites, owing to the readiness with which the minerals are changed by the substitution of potash for soda and lime, accompanied by a large loss of water and an increase in density.
